This replaces some uses of pg_attribute_aligned() with the standard alignas() for cases where extended alignment (larger than max_align_t) is required. This patch stipulates that all supported compilers must support alignments up to PG_IO_ALIGN_SIZE, but that seems pretty likely. We can then also desupport the case where direct I/O is disabled because pg_attribute_aligned is not supported.
